Gusau Confident Super Eagles Will Triumph in Playoffs: “We Have What It Takes”

President of the Nigeria Football Federation (NFF), Alhaji Ibrahim Musa Gusau, has expressed strong confidence that the Super Eagles possess the quality and determination needed to win their World Cup playoff fixtures scheduled to take place next month in Morocco.

Speaking to reporters, Gusau emphasized that the players understand what it means to represent Nigeria on the world stage and are fully aware of the magnitude of qualifying for the World Cup.

He noted that the team’s performances in their last two matches demonstrated hunger, unity, and renewed focus.

“The players have shown great zeal and awareness of what’s at stake,” Gusau said. “They know how important it is for Nigeria to be at the World Cup, and I am confident that with their mindset and commitment, we will make it.”

The NFF boss further revealed that the federation is receiving full support from the Federal Government to ensure smooth preparations ahead of the playoffs.

He praised the collaboration between the Ministry of Sports and the Federation, noting that logistics, welfare, and other technical areas are being adequately taken care of.

“We are grateful for the government’s continuous backing,” he added. “Our preparations are on course, and by God’s grace, everything will work out well. The team has the potential, and now it’s about staying focused and finishing strong.”

Gusau’s confidence reflects a growing optimism within the NFF, as Nigeria aims to secure one of Africa’s spots at the 2026 FIFA World Cup in the United States, Mexico, and Canada.
